Queer as Folk (U.S.) is a flawed, fearless, and foundational text in television history. It refused to apologize for queer desire, demanded visibility during the height of “Don’t Ask, Don’t Tell” and the Defense of Marriage Act, and created a rich, messy, unforgettable family of characters. While some aspects have aged poorly, its core message – that gay lives are as ordinary, extraordinary, and worthy of drama as any others – changed television forever. Unlike its contemporaries, Queer as Folk prioritized the internal dynamics of the community. It wasn't interested in explaining "gayness" to a straight audience; instead, it focused on the authentic joys, vices, and struggles of its characters. It tackled issues that were then-taboo for television, including recreational drug use, the nuances of HIV/AIDS in the post-cocktail era, gay parenting, and the politics of "coming out."
